It is hard to find a city as unique as Edinburgh, with its ancient Edinburgh Castle and Royal Mile whilst on the other side of Princes street is the New town. The best hotels are in the city center and make seeing all of these sites a breeze.
Two nights is a must in order to see the best of Edinburgh. Hotels near Princes street or the Royal Mile are a bit more pricey but you find that with Hotels that are further out you will end up paying more for taxi’s and bus fares. The must do’s include: Visiting Edinburgh Castle, a stroll along the Royal Mile, a bus tour and a relaxing walk in the Royal Gardens. If this is not enough to tire you out there is always a pub crawl to top the day off.
Princes street has all the high street names and the Grass-market now has a buzzing night-life. Mid week is the ideal time to visit as prices and availability of hotels are most favorable. Edinburgh festival and the Tattoo are very popular events and as such are reflected in the prices of rooms.
With the Internet it is now much easier to find a 3 star hotel. However problems may arise if you are looking for triple or quad rooms as these are limited, and making sure that they are good quality. Review sites are helpful as they provide lots on information from past customers.
As Edinburgh is such a popular destination and with relatively few hotels you can expect prices to be as higher or in some cases higher than in London. Best prices can be found mid-week and during the off season. Price comparison and review sites can be goldmines of information and the best way to find good prices. Just be aware that there may be extra charges involved.
